body {
	margin: 0px; background: #ffffff; 
	background-image: url(images/bg_pg.jpg); background-repeat: repeat-y; background-position: top center;
	
	/* scrollbar colors */
	/* outer lines */
	scrollbar-3dlight-color: #000000;
	scrollbar-darkshadow-color: #000000;
	/* inner lines */
	scrollbar-highlight-color: #bdbdbd;
	scrollbar-shadow-color: #bdbdbd;
	/* face, arrow and track */
	scrollbar-face-color: #30445F;
	scrollbar-arrow-color: #a3a3a3;
	scrollbar-track-color: #a3a3a3;
}

/* set the page font formatting. */
body, p {font-family: verdana, sans-serif; font-size: 11px; line-height: 18px; }

/* default link colors - this is the default link color for the page */
A:link { color: #D8171F; text-decoration: none; }
A:visited { color: #BA242B; text-decoration: none; }
A:hover { color: #FF000B; text-decoration: underline; }
A:active { color: #FF000B; text-decoration: underline; }
A:visited:hover { color: #FF000B; text-decoration: underline; }

A.color1:link { color: #999999; text-decoration: none;}
A.color1:visited { color: #999999; text-decoration: none; }
A.color1:active { color: #666666; text-decoration: underline; }
A.color1:hover { color: #666666; text-decoration: underline; }
A.color1:visited:hover { color: #666666; text-decoration: underline; }

A.color2:link { color: #FFD900; text-decoration: none; }
A.color2:visited{ color: #FF000B; text-decoration: none; }
A.color2:active { color: #ffffff; text-decoration: underline; }
A.color2:hover { color: #ffffff; text-decoration: underline; }
A.color2:visited:hover{ color: #ffffff; text-decoration: underline; }

A.aunderline:link { color: #D8171F; text-decoration: underline; }
A.aunderline:visited{ color: #FF000B; text-decoration: underline; }
A.aunderline:active { color: #D8171F; text-decoration: underline; }
A.aunderline:hover { color: #FF000B; text-decoration: underline; }
A.aunderline:visited:hover{ color: #FF000B; text-decoration: underline; }


/* TABLE STYLES */

td.tdamTOP{background-color:#d8d8d8; border-left:#d8d8d8 solid 1px; 
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: bold;
	text-transform: uppercase;
	color: #000000;}
td.tdamLF {border-left: #d8d8d8 solid 1px;}
td.tdamLL {border-left: #d8d8d8 solid 1px; border-bottom: #d8d8d8 solid 1px;}
td.tdamBOT {border-bottom: #d8d8d8 solid 1px;}
td.tdamLR {border-bottom: #d8d8d8 solid 1px; border-right: #d8d8d8 solid 1px;}
td.tdamRT {border-right: #d8d8d8 solid 1px;}

p.pannounce {font-size:14px; font-weight:bold; border:solid #eed8d8 1px; background-color:#ffeeee; padding:20px;}

.bodyblk {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	line-height: 11pt;
	color: #000000;
}
.bodywht {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	color: #ffffff;
}
.highlightred {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-transform: none;
	color: #731418;
}
.subheadblu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: bold;
	text-transform: uppercase;
	color: D8171F;
}
.subheadblulg {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11pt;
	font-weight: bold;
	text-transform: uppercase;
	color: D8171F;
}
.subheadwht {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	font-weight: bold;
	color: ffffff;
}
.utilblu {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: small-caps;
	text-transform: capitalize;
	color: 89CDF7;
}
.utillt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	font-variant: small-caps;
	text-transform: capitalize;
	color: cccccc;
}
.subheadwht {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	font-weight: bold;
	text-transform: uppercase;
	color: #FFFFFF;
}
.credits {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: bold;
	color: #000000;
}
.bodyboldblk {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	line-height: 10pt;
	font-weight: bold;
	color: #333333;
}
.list01 {
	list-style-position: outside;
	list-style-type: disc;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10pt;
	line-height: 12pt;
	font-weight: bold;
	color: #333333;

}
.navtop {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	line-height: 9pt;
	font-weight: bold;
	text-transform: uppercase;
	color: #000000;
}
.creditslt {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	font-weight: bold;
	color: #999999;
}
.listlg {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	line-height: 10pt;
	font-weight: bold;
	text-transform: capitalize;
	color: #CC0000;
}
.listlg2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	line-height: 11pt;
	font-weight: bold;
	text-transform: capitalize;
	color: #CC0000;
}

.fdirectors {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	line-height: 9pt;
	font-weight: bold;
	text-transform: capitalize;
	color: #000000;
}

.fdir-email {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 7pt;
	line-height: 9pt;
	text-transform: capitalize;
	color: #ff0000;
}

/* form fields */
.formbold { font-size : 12px;
	font-weight: bold;
	font-family: Verdana;
	border: 1px inset #00639E;
}

.formnormal { font-size : 10px;
	font-weight: bold;
	font-family: Verdana;
	border: 1px inset #00639E;
}

.style1 {font-family: Verdana, Arial, Helvetica, sans-serif}
.style2 {font-size: 8pt; font-weight: bold; text-transform: uppercase; font-family: Verdana, Arial, Helvetica, sans-serif;}